    RICKY DONE FOR SEASON
    by Michael David Smith

    The Ricky Williams comeback tour lasted one game and six carries.

    Tim Graham of the Palm Beach Post reports that Williams' season is over after he suffered a torn chest muscle in Monday night's loss to the Steelers. The injury will require about four months to fully recover, Graham reports.

    The injury took place in the second quarter, when Williams was hit, fumbled and fell to the ground and was then stepped on by Steelers linebacker Lawrence Timmons. It was Williams' first game in almost two years, after he was suspended for violations of the league's substance-abuse policy.

    "It's just sad," Graham quotes Williams' agent, Leigh Steinberg, saying. "As hard as he's worked. He worked so hard physically to get back into shape and in therapy. He worked so hard for that moment and to have it end this way is sad."

    Graham reports that the Dolphins want Williams to rehab the injury at the team's facilities, indicating that they're open to having Williams on the team in 2008.
